Lawn debris cleanup services involve removing fallen leaves, twigs, grass clippings, and other organic materials that accumulate on a property’s yard. This work helps maintain a tidy and attractive outdoor space, preventing debris from smothering grass and plants. Regular cleanup can also reduce the risk of pests and mold growth that can occur when debris is left to decompose. Whether it’s after a storm, during seasonal changes, or as part of routine yard maintenance, professionals can handle the removal efficiently to keep lawns looking neat and healthy.

This service addresses common problems such as yard clutter, overgrown debris, and the buildup of organic waste that can hinder grass growth or create safety hazards. Debris can block drainage areas, leading to water pooling or erosion, and can also attract pests like insects or rodents seeking shelter. The overview below groups typical Lawn Debris Cleanup proj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Longview, WA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Small debris removal - For routine lawn debris cleanup, local contractors typically charge between $150 and $400. Many standard jobs fall within this range, covering leaf and small branch removal from yards in Longview and nearby areas.

Medium-sized projects - Larger cleanup jobs, such as clearing multiple bags of leaves or larger branches, usually cost between $400 and $1,000. These projects are common during peak fall seasons when yard debris volume increases.

Extensive cleanups - For more comprehensive debris removal involving significant yard clearing or large branches, costs can range from $1,000 to $2,500. Fewer projects reach this tier, often involving larger or more complex properties.

Full yard restoration - Complete debris cleanup and yard restoration, including removal of heavy debris and landscaping cleanup, can exceed $2,500 and reach $5,000+ for larger, more complex projects. These are less common but necessary for extensive property overhauls.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
